The Dashboard polls in the background so you don't have to refresh by hand. The dropdown at the top right of the page controls the cadence.
| Setting | When to use |
|---|---|
| 30s | During an incident or release window. Tightest cadence. |
| 1m | Default. Reasonable for routine monitoring without burning bandwidth. |
| 5m | When the Dashboard is on a big screen in the team area as ambient information. |
| Off | Snapshot mode — useful when you want to compare values before / after an action without numbers shifting under you. |
The setting is per-user, per-browser. Your colleagues' Dashboards refresh independently.
Each refresh re-fetches all six tiles. There's no incremental update — the platform doesn't push diffs to the Dashboard. Light load per refresh; safe to leave at 30s for hours.
The refresh is also paused when the browser tab is in the background (browser-level throttling). When you come back to the tab, the next refresh fires within the cadence window.
